From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p2 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id sL3MOCHaE2HicQEAgWs5BA (envelope-from ) for ; Wed, 11 Aug 2021 16:09:37 +0200 Received: from aspmx1.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p2 with LMTPS id cDW3NCHaE2F1WgAAB5/wlQ (envelope-from ) for ; Wed, 11 Aug 2021 14:09:37 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id E63894FC5 for ; Wed, 11 Aug 2021 16:09:36 +0200 (CEST) Received: from localhost ([::1]:36338 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mDovH-00037X-JF for larch@yhetil.org; Wed, 11 Aug 2021 10:09:35 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:36908)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mDouk-0002VQ-At for guix-patches@gnu.org; Wed, 11 Aug 2021 10:09:02 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:52892)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mDouk-0007jv-1I for guix-patches@gnu.org; Wed, 11 Aug 2021 10:09:02 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1mDouj-0006Jv-T5 for guix-patches@gnu.org; Wed, 11 Aug 2021 10:09:01 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#49859] Remove packages that depend on unsupported old OpenSSL releases Resent-From: Ludovic =?UTF-8?Q?Court=C3=A8s?=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Wed, 11 Aug 2021 14:09: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 49859 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: Efraim Flashner Cc: Julien Lepiller , 49859@debbugs.gnu.org, Leo Famulari Received: via spool by 49859-submit@debbugs.gnu.org id=B49859.162869091424253 (code B ref 49859); Wed, 11 Aug 2021 14:09:01 +0000 Received: (at 49859) by debbugs.gnu.org; 11 Aug 2021 14:08:34 +0000 Received: from localhost ([127.0.0.1]:36205 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mDouI-0006J7-7u for submit@debbugs.gnu.org; Wed, 11 Aug 2021 10:08:34 -0400 Received: from eggs.gnu.org ([209.51.188.92]:56114)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mDouF-0006Is-Sc for 49859@debbugs.gnu.org; Wed, 11 Aug 2021 10:08:32 -0400 Received: from fencepost.gnu.org ([2001:470:142:3::e]:60434) by eggs.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mDou8-0007Md-5F; Wed, 11 Aug 2021 10:08:24 -0400 Received: from [2a01:e0a:1d:7270:af76:b9b:ca24:c465] (port=48756 helo=ribbon) by fencepost.gnu.org with esmtpsa (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mDou7-0007ku-SP; Wed, 11 Aug 2021 10:08:24 -0400 From: Ludovic =?UTF-8?Q?Court=C3=A8s?= References: <98b6d8eee70e27683b6617ba92afd7a353514e45.1628040049.git.leo@famulari.name> <83DA07E5-55F3-4F1C-9C57-8957526A53B6@lepiller.eu> Date: Wed, 11 Aug 2021 16:08:21 +0200 In-Reply-To: (Efraim Flashner's message of "Thu, 5 Aug 2021 11:11:53 +0300") Message-ID: <877dgsm5uy.fsf_-_@gnu.org>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/27.2 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: "Guix-patches" X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1628690977;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:resent-cc: resent-from:resent-sender:resent-message-id: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post; bh=XGtRewAKeWHRJP/1nIJZtWwgmqIEWirz+IUPGMGl9nk=; b=IOU8YDYcgHuWod27cQMfhQqyZhr/9b6zWWqK9aCPYgeMr97WIiW+Df3HM1u3tZOvzuTenq pO2+omUpGlgDP0WIs3H+cJoYb0wxwm6zMcGcnvrtczz8wNTtBrs24ndb7U9CxFv4A/+ghr QH5ZUJDL1Ju7Nz8bip676rrOcJyDv1c8NBxEQOIy/g6gwP4X1ZiwjrPOW8TbkJyaXbijlI v79ND17UfHt1y8E/S305iRNg+wyzYq6zc8BTNZoc/P32O7haK2jK46zDyJ5YVx+CL4nJd/ XCdqJDGhs+O6K5HBcfW1Wgp17bN+e47HdVdOJeuyHPOsxhXIgemupghsOhgCvw==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1628690977; a=rsa-sha256; cv=none; b=JTH6VjnEqIOcdqBhp96OunFYwjy5k0/8rvELA/yHohNWIEdVANcR+na7iaf2NubF2UsPyN tzTuJFjR2DmGTsBCn9DjYKD8CpyGhGTkI6xR33/+9v4Cx4otn0eemQt3mAlkMNs4WLYm7X b/SQT7QaQHKemoOJ2ScDZ00uJ/vJWaHiG9ZCkwXf+Kf23vEfkcd0C4lronqBMB674z9S18 jNRLtW8tRcSx+CbGsMxt6awCb68H2ZHHfB8uIlAO55q3Vxq6uS3ZciUM4AOiKV8bGttcxH ImLkTj+B5Rznk1y538euEDoODg7tFNYRmgHjcpLghR7rZpucUwl4lZwN397eBQ==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=none; dmarc=pass (policy=none) header.from=gnu.org;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Spam-Score: -2.91 Authentication-Results: aspmx1.migadu.com; dkim=none; dmarc=pass (policy=none) header.from=gnu.org;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Queue-Id: E63894FC5 X-Spam-Score: -2.91 X-Migadu-Scanner: scn0.migadu.com X-TUID: eWCW8+M1uO+Q Hi, Efraim Flashner skribis: > I'm in favor of moving openssl-1.0 to guix-past, it's the perfect type > of package to go there. Upstream has declared it dead and no one is > going to touch it. Similar to how qt-4 moved there a few months ago. Agreed. However=E2=80=A6 > ADB and fastboot are still useful, and (ignoring some networking options > they apparently have) are localhost only. I'd rather leave them both for > now with an eye to shoehorning in an updated version somehow, hiding > openssl-1.0, and adding a note to remove it as soon as nothing needs it > anymore. =E2=80=A6 this means we need to keep openssl 1.0, hidden, in Guix proper. = That sounds like a reasonable option to me. Leo=E2=80=99s approach of progressi= vely removing anything that depends on it sounds good to me nevertheless, but it=E2=80=99s good that we can weigh the pros and cons for each candidate. Julien said upgrading ADB/fastboot is not an option, at least not now. Another option would be to patch ADB so it can use OpenSSL 1.1. Hopefully the changes can be relatively simple and isolated. Worth trying? Ludo=E2=80=99.